FIRE 130 - NWCG Basic Firefighter Field Day
Associated Term: Spring 2024
Learning Objectives: Upon successful completion of this course, the student will be able to:
1.Satisfy the field-based exercise requirements for NWCG course S130 including the practical application of wildland firefighting skills involved in:
a. Standard Firefighting Orders and Watch Out Situations
b. Lookouts, Communications, Escape Routes, and Safety Zones (LCES) system is and how it relates to the Standard Firefighting Orders
c. Various communication methods and tools used for collecting, producing, and distributing information
d. Standards, tools and equipment, and various methods used in fireline construction
e. Methods for extinguishing a fire with or without the use of water
f. Constructing a fireline to required standards using various methods, tools and equipment, and techniques
